Baroque Music in a Western-style House: 17th and 18th Century French Music
In late March, the park overlooking Yokohama Port is filled with the fragrant scent of spring flowers in full bloom.
We will be performing baroque music on old-style instruments (baroque oboe, viola da gamba, and harpsichord) in the hall of the British House in Yokohama, a Western-style building originally built as the British Consulate General. Please enjoy this spring moment at your leisure.

British House in Yokohama![]() It was built in 1937 as the official residence of the British Consul General. It is a two-story reinforced concrete building with a stately British design, and the high-positioned doorknobs give an indication that it was once home to British people. It is adjacent to the rose garden in Minato Mirai Park, and in May, June, October, and November, the house is filled with the scent of colorful roses. |
